Farage doing his Trump tribute act again - "They're eating the swans.." 13:02 - Sep 24 with 4926 views | ElderGrizzly | "Royal Parks say no evidence to back Nigel Farage’s claim that migrants are eating their swans" - Yes, someone had to come out and refute this. He claimed this morning on LBC immigrants are catching, killing and eating swans in Royal Parks. "If I said to you that swans were being eaten in royal parks and carps were being taken out of ponds and eaten in this country from people with different cultures. Would you agree that is happening?" Asked who was doing this, Farage said “people who come from countries where it’s quite acceptable to do so”. Asked if he meant eastern Europeans, he replied: “So I believe.” [Post edited 24 Sep 13:03]

Take: one woodcock, place inside a pigeon, place pigeon inside a partridge, partridge inside pheasant, inside a chicken, mallard duck, goose and finally, a swan. Roast for many hours, then re-dress in swan plumage. To really impress, at this stage gild the feathers with gold. Serves approximately 30 people. Reputedly seen occasionaly at medieval feasts. |  |
